排列和组合的区别
1个回答
展开全部
是否按次序排列
1、排列:从n个不同的元素中,取r个不重复的元素,按次序排列,称为从n个中取知r个的无重复排列。
2、组合:从n个不同的元素中,取r个不重复的元素,组成一个子集,而不考虑其元素的顺序,称为从n个中取r个的无重组合。
符号表示不同
1、排列A(n,r)
2、组合版C(n,r)
比如在3个数中选择2个数,组合方法有C(3,2)=3种,是12、13、23。而排列方法有12、21、13、31、23、32共A(3,2)=6种,组合对数据顺序无关,排列对数据顺序有关联。
排列算法:
排列,一般地,从n个不同元素中取出m (m≤n)个元素,按照一定的顺序排成一列,叫做从n个元素中取出m个元素的一个排列(permutation)。特别地,当m-n时,这个排列被称作全排列(all
permutation)。
排列(permutation),数学的重要概念之一。有限集的子集按某种条件的序化法排成列、排成一圈、不许重复或许重复等。从n个不同元素中每次取出m (1≤m≤n)个不同元素,排成一列,称为从n个元素中取出m个元素的无重复排列或直线排列,简称排列。
从n个不同元素中取出m个不同元素的所有不同排列的个数称为排列种数或称排列数。